About Stephen Brooks:

Stephen G. Brooks is a Professor of Government at Dartmouth, and has previously held fellowships at Harvard and Princeton. His research examines two topics: U.S. grand strategy and how economic factors influence security affairs. He is the author of five books: Producing Security: Multinational Corporations, Globalization, and the Changing Calculus of Conflict (Princeton, 2005); World out of Balance: International Relations and the Challenge of American Primacy (Princeton, 2008), with William Wohlforth; America Abroad: The United States’ Global Role in the 21st Century (Oxford, 2016), with William Wohlforth; Command of Commerce: America’s Enduring Economic Power Advantage Over China (Oxford, 2025), with Ben Vagle; and Political Economy of Security (Princeton, forthcoming).  

He has published numerous articles in scholarly journals such as International Security, International Organization, Journal of Conflict Resolution, Journal of Politics, Perspectives on Politics, and Security Studies. He has also published eight general interest articles in Foreign Affairs. He received his Ph.D. in Political Science with Distinction from Yale University, where his dissertation received the American Political Science Association's Helen Dwight Reid Award for the best doctoral dissertation in international relations, law, and politics.
